教えて!ExcelVBA!

ExcelVBAの基礎知識・書き方について紹介します。

ExcelVBAでフォームをダブルクリック時に自動処理する方法

構文

構文は以下の通りです。

Private Sub UserForm_DblClick(ByVal Cancel As MSForms.ReturnBoolean)
    ' 処理内容をここに書きます
End Sub

解説

UserForm_DblClickは、ユーザーフォームがダブルクリックされたときに自動的に実行されるイベントです。

プログラミング例

具体的なプログラミング例を紹介します。

Private Sub UserForm_DblClick(ByVal Cancel As MSForms.ReturnBoolean)
    MsgBox "フォームがダブルクリックされました。"
End Sub

上記プログラムは、フォームがダブルクリックされたときにメッセージを表示する内容です。

まとめ

フォームがダブルクリックされたときに自動的に処理を実行する方法として、UserForm_DblClickイベントを使用します。このイベントを利用することで、ユーザーがフォームをダブルクリックした瞬間に特定のアクションを実行させることができます。